For whatever reason, it's the away team that's had the advantage when Central Bucks East and Bensalem meet (four straight games heading into this one) and that held true again on Wednesday. The Patriots fell just short of the Fighting Owls by a score of 10-8. The Patriots were given a dose of their own medicine in this game as the Fighting Owls apparently hadn't forgotten their loss the last time these teams played back in March of 2025.
Sydney Hahn made the most of her time in the batter's box despite the final result and went 2-for-3 with one home run and four RBI. The team also got some help courtesy of Sarah Zmuda, who went 2-for-3 with one stolen base, one run, and one RBI.
Central Bucks East's defeat was their seventh straight at home dating back to last season, which dropped their record down to 1-1.
Both teams are looking forward to the support of their home crowds in their upcoming games. Central Bucks East will welcome Neshaminy at 3:45 p.m. on Friday. As for Bensalem, they will be defending their home field for the first time this season when they go up against Hatboro-Horsham at 3:45 p.m. on Friday.
